    318Ti rear, no adjusters, et20 wheel fitment PICS

    I am posting this as a reference to those of you who are wondering what offset to use with 318ti rears. I am not trying to start a stance war, there is just alot of bad info out there about offsets and 318ti rear set-ups. As you can see I obviously need fender rolling and I'll obviously have to use small(ish) tires. I don't need anyone telling me this.

    Wheel specs:

    17x8 et20 OEM e60 5 series wheels

    No weld on adjusters or eccentric bushings. The rear of my car is straight up delrin.

                              I currenly run 235/40 goodyear f1 asymmetric on 17x8 et38 with coil overs all the way down. e36 5 lug f and r, -2.5 camber out back. Slight rubbing with a minor fender roll.
